Allianz Real Estate France has acquired Climmolux Holding, the company owning the Serenity office building
Paris/Munich, 05/20/2016.
The property was sold by Fidentia, a Belgian real estate investor. The Serenity building was completed in 2010 and covers an area of approximately 10,486 m². Around 532 parking spaces are available.
In 2010 the Serenity office building was the first building in Luxembourg to have been awarded the HQE (NF HQE Tertiary Buildings) certification for the construction of the building. Since November 2014 the property has also enjoyed the HQE level "Excellent" certification for the use of the building.
"This first acquisition in Luxembourg, on behalf of Allianz' investors, enables us to strenghten the geographic diversification within our portfolio", said Barbara Koreniouguine, CEO of Allianz Real Estate France, which also covers the Benelux region.
In this transaction, Allianz was advised by Arendt & Medernach, EY et Socotec. Fidentia Real Estate Investments was advised by JLL and Heilporn & Kadaner. Further terms of the transaction were not disclosed.
